Technical recordThe registered claim, mechanism and falsification criteriaTH-20260905-rust-bitboard-improvements-1c56b072
Claim
Avoiding unused leaf work and cache hashing reduces fixed-depth CPU cost without changing any value bits; cache scope and depth expose a measurable memory/work frontier.
Mechanism
Guard zero-readiness supporter gathering, bypass hashing below table depth, and compare private versus optimistic full-key shared memoization.
Falsification criteria
  1. Any value-bit mismatch rejects an optimization; a median speed ratio below 1.03 rejects a default performance change.
